The Spark Before the Flame

Few signs feel things as immediately as Aries. Ruled by Mars, the planet of drive and assertion, an Aries does not tend to let emotions simmer in silence. When they are hurt, you usually find out quickly, and when they are angry, the temperature in the room shifts.

Yet there is a gift hidden inside that intensity. Aries anger tends to burn hot and fast, like a flare rather than a slow-smoldering coal. Once you understand the rhythm of how Aries reacts and recovers, what can look like volatility starts to read as honesty. This is a sign that wears its heart in plain sight.

Why Aries Reacts Fast

The Aries response to pain is rooted in their fire nature. They are wired for action, so when something wounds them, the instinct is to respond, not retreat. Where a more reserved sign might withdraw to process privately, Aries often confronts the issue head-on.

A few things drive this pattern:

  • Mars rules quick reaction. Aries feels the surge of emotion and the urge to act almost simultaneously, leaving little gap for second-guessing.
  • Directness feels safer than suppression. Holding feelings in goes against the Aries grain. They would rather have the hard conversation now than carry resentment for weeks.
  • Pride is tender. Aries cares more about respect than they sometimes admit. A blow to their dignity can spark a stronger reaction than the original problem.

It helps to remember that an Aries outburst is rarely cold or calculated. It is a release valve, not a strategy.

Hurt Often Hides Behind the Anger

Here is the part many people miss. When an Aries snaps, the surface emotion is anger, but the deeper feeling is often hurt, disappointment, or fear of being undervalued. Anger feels powerful and active, which is far more comfortable to an Aries than the vulnerability of admitting they feel sad or rejected.

If you love an Aries, learning to look past the heat to the wound underneath changes everything. A sharp comment frequently translates to I felt dismissed. A burst of frustration often means I needed you and did not feel met. Responding to the real feeling, rather than the volume, tends to dissolve the conflict far faster than matching their intensity.

This emotional honesty is also part of what makes Aries so vivid in love. The same openness that shows up in their intimacy and emotional style in relationships is what makes their anger so visible. They simply do not hide what they feel.

How Aries Heals

The good news about Aries fire is how quickly it passes. Most Aries do not hold grudges the way other signs might. Once the storm has moved through and they feel heard, they are usually ready to move forward, sometimes faster than the other person is.

To heal, an Aries typically needs:

  • To be heard, not managed. Acknowledging their feelings goes much further than trying to calm them down.
  • A clean resolution. Aries dislikes lingering ambiguity. Naming the issue and agreeing on a way forward helps them release it.
  • Physical movement. A walk, a workout, or simply changing environments helps Aries metabolize big emotions and reset.
  • Respect restored. If pride was wounded, a genuine acknowledgment of their worth helps them let go.

What Aries does not respond well to is stonewalling, cold withdrawal, or being told they are overreacting. Those responses keep the fire fed rather than letting it burn out.

Loving an Aries Through Conflict

Conflict with an Aries does not have to be destructive. In fact, handled well, it can deepen trust. Aries respects a partner or friend who can stand their ground without escalating, who stays warm even when things get heated, and who does not punish them for being expressive.

Growth: From Reaction to Response

The growth path for Aries is learning to insert a small pause between feeling and action. That single breath gives them the chance to choose their response rather than be swept into it. Aries who develop this skill keep all of their honesty and courage while losing the regret that sometimes follows a quick reaction.

It also helps for Aries to name the softer feeling out loud. Saying I felt hurt instead of simply lashing out invites connection rather than conflict. This is not about suppressing their fire; it is about aiming it with intention.
